Dental hygiene therapists tend to focus on the more basic routine dentistry work that dentists have to carry out. Their job is to educate you on the importance of dental hygiene and treat patients using the following types of procedures (not limited to):

  • Oral assessments
  • Dental scaling and polishing 
  • Taking dental x-rays
  • Teeth whitening

The importance of dental hygiene

By taking regular visits to The Smile Boutiques hygienist team, we will help make sure that your gums and teeth always remain clean and healthy. The dental hygiene therapist will remove any hidden and hard-to-reach plaque lurking, which if left uncleaned, may lead to gum disease. We help you get to the root of any problem before more severe dental issues begin.

Most importantly of all, tooth decay and gum disease are the biggest reasons why you may lose one, two, or more teeth as adults. If gum disease worsens without the care and treatment from a dentist, it can, unfortunately, lead to tender, swollen and painful bleeding gums. And that’s without mentioning the bad breath that comes with it! Some studies prove that gum disease is even associated with very serious health issues like heart disease, strokes, and diabetes.

In addition to preventing the onset of severe gum disease and other serious health issues, a visit to your dental hygiene therapist will also include:

  • The maintenance of whiter and brighter teeth.
  • The polishing of your teeth to remove stains.
  • The learning of important information and advice on good oral hygiene.

What to expect when you visit a dental hygiene therapist 

Any dentist appointment can feel daunting, but here at The Smile Boutique, you’ve got nothing to worry about.

You should expect three things when you visit a dental hygiene appointment:

  1. An initial examination and general check-up of your teeth and gums.
  2. The scaling of your teeth to remove any plaque in, around, and between your teeth. 
  3. Personal advice on how you can maintain your oral hygiene. 

If your dental hygiene therapist spots any major signs of severe gum disease, they may refer you to a periodontist to treat the issue with more complex dentistry procedures.

There’s a scientific knack to effective tooth brushing, so here are five things you need to remember: 

  • Don’t disregard the importance of flossing!
  • Preferably use an electric toothbrush.
  • Don’t forget about cleaning your tongue (this will help with bad breath).
  • Brush for around 2 minutes (both day and night!) 
  • Don’t wash your mouth out after (any remaining fluoride will be washed away).

Both dentists and dental hygienists are qualified, registered professionals and can carry out a range of everyday dental treatments.
However, dentists have a broader range of skills that enable them to restore and treat your teeth and gums – whereas hygienists specialise in the cleaning, scaling, and polishing of the teeth to preserve them and prevent oral diseases like periodontal (gum) disease.
For example, if you need a filling or a tooth extraction, you should see your regular dentist, and if you’re looking to keep on top of plaque build-up, prevent gum disease or need expert oral hygiene tips, you should see a hygienist.

Between appointments with your hygienist, there are some things you can do to improve and maintain your oral health at home:
Brush your teeth twice a day – Not only is brushing twice a day important but the way you brush your teeth, too. Take your time, spending 30 seconds in each quadrant of your mouth brushing in gentle circular motions to remove debris and plaque. If you can, invest in an electric toothbrush. They make brushing your teeth much easier and do a much better job of removing plaque and build-up on your teeth.
Use fluoride toothpaste – When choosing a toothpaste, make sure to pick one that has fluoride. Fluoride is a leading defence against tooth decay and acts as a protective barrier for your teeth.
Don’t forget to brush your tongue – Your tongue is a hotspot for bacteria, so brushing it is just as important as brushing your teeth if you want to avoid tooth decay and bad breath.
Floss at least once a day – Many people forget to floss, but you need to do so at least once a day. Not only does this remove plaque debris from between your teeth, but it also stimulates the gums and helps reduce inflammation.

Visiting a hygienist every couple of months for a scale and polish will remove surface stains and encourage healthy gums.
With this being part of your dental routine, your teeth will, naturally, appear much brighter.
However, it’s important to remember that a hygienist won’t be able to whiten your teeth beyond their natural shade, and if you wish to change the shade of your teeth, you should consider teeth whitening treatments to achieve this.
